How to Find the IP Address of a Network Printer


1. First click the Start Menu - Devices and Printers.
Discover Menu Control Panel is an important first step to find the IP address of your printer. Control Panel is one of the main options available in the "Start" menu located at the bottom left corner of Windows. In the Control Panel, you will find lots of icons and options that you can click. Find the label "Printers" or "Printers and Scanners," but if you are using Windows Vista section was in "Hardware and Sound".



2. Once you find a window like the image below, right-click on the printer that is installed on your computer and click Printer Properties.



3. Next in the window that appears click the General tab and locate the IP address in the Location field. That's the IP address of your printer.



4. If you do not find, try clicking on the Ports tab menu - put checks on the choice of a standard TCP / IP Port and click the Configure Port button.



5. So then the IP address of the printer will be displayed again at the window.
